Address 1659 DOGE

DFzEo6TPFT6zRvmmVaR38wmw5Trr9jJdRv

Confirmed

Total Received 1659 DOGE
Total Sent 0 DOGE
Final Balance 1659 DOGE
No. Transactions 1

Transactions